Parmesan Fried Tortellini this Recipe

Ingredients:

  • 1 (20 ounce) package refrigerated cheese tortellini
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 2 large eggs, beaten
  • 1 cup panko bread crumbs
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• Vegetable oil, for frying
  • Marinara sauce, for serving (optional)
  • Fresh parsley, chopped, for garnish (optional)

Preparing the Tortellini and Breading Station

Okay, let’s get started! First things first, we need to get our tortellini ready for its Parmesan-crusted makeover. This involves setting up a breading station, which is super easy but crucial for getting that perfect crispy coating.

  1. Cook the Tortellini: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the tortellini and cook according to the package directions, usually about 3-5 minutes, or until they float to the surface. Don’t overcook them, as they’ll be fried later. We want them al dente!
  2. Drain and Cool: Once cooked, immediately drain the tortellini and rinse them under cold water to stop the cooking process. This prevents them from becoming mushy. Spread them out on a baking sheet lined with paper towels to dry completely. This is important because dry tortellini will hold the breading much better.
  3. Set Up the Breading Station: Now for the fun part! Prepare three shallow dishes. In the first dish, place the all-purpose flour. In the second dish, whisk the eggs until they are well combined. In the third dish, combine the panko bread crumbs, Parmesan cheese, garlic powder, dried oregano, salt, and pepper. Mix well to ensure all the spices are evenly distributed.

Breading the Tortellini

This is where the magic happens! We’re going to coat each tortellini in our delicious Parmesan mixture. Take your time and make sure each one is fully covered for maximum flavor and crispiness.

  1. Flour Power: Take a handful of the cooled and dried tortellini and dredge them in the flour, making sure they are completely coated. Shake off any excess flour. This helps the egg adhere properly.
  2. Egg Wash: Next, dip the floured tortellini into the beaten eggs, again ensuring they are fully coated. Let any excess egg drip off.
  3. Parmesan Crust: Finally, transfer the egg-coated tortellini to the panko bread crumb mixture. Press gently to ensure the bread crumbs adhere to all sides. You want a nice, thick coating.
  4. Repeat: Repeat the breading process with the remaining tortellini until they are all coated.
  5. Chill Time (Optional but Recommended): For best results, place the breaded tortellini on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per and refrigerate them for at least 30 minutes. This helps the breading set and prevents it from falling off during frying. You can even refrigerate them for a couple of hours if you have the time.

Frying the Tortellini

Alright, time to fry! This is where we transform our breaded tortellini into golden-brown, crispy perfection. Make sure you have everything ready before you start, as the frying process goes quickly.

  1. Heat the Oil: Pour enough vegetable oil into a large, heavy-bottomed pot or deep fryer to reach a depth of about 2-3 inches. Heat the oil over medium-high heat until it reaches a temperature of 350-375°F (175-190°C). You can use a deep-fry thermometer to monitor the temperature. If you don’t have a thermometer, you can test the oil by dropping a small piece of bread into it. If the bread turns golden brown in about 30-60 seconds, the oil is ready.
  2. Fry in Batches: Carefully add the breaded tortellini to the hot oil in batches, being careful not to overcrowd the pot. Overcrowding will lower the oil temperature and result in soggy tortellini.
  3. Cook Until Golden: Fry the tortellini for about 2-3 minutes per batch, or until they are golden brown and crispy on all sides. Use a slotted spoon or spider to turn them occasionally to ensure even cooking.
  4. Drain on Paper Towels: Remove the fried tortellini from the oil and place them on a baking sheet lined with paper towels to drain any excess oil.

Tips for Success

  • Don’t Overcrowd the Pan: When frying, make sure not to overcrowd the pan. This will lower the oil temperature and result in soggy tortellini. Fry in batches for best results.
  • Keep the Oil Hot: Maintaining the correct oil temperature is crucial for crispy tortellini. Use a thermometer to monitor the temperature and adjust the heat as needed.
  • Dry Tortellini is Key: Make sure the cooked tortellini are completely dry before breading. This will help the breading adhere properly.
  • Refrigerate for Extra Crispiness: Refrigerating the breaded tortellini for at least 30 minutes before frying helps the breading set and prevents it from falling off.
  • Season Generously: Don’t be afraid to season the bread crumb mixture generously with garlic powder, oregano, salt, and pepper. This will add tons of flavor to the tortellini.

Variations

  • Different Cheeses: Experiment with different types of cheese in the bread crumb mixture. Pecorino Romano, Asiago, or even a blend of cheeses would be delicious.
  • Spicy Kick: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the bread crumb mixture for a spicy kick.
  • Herb Infusion: Add fresh herbs like basil, thyme, or rosemary to the bread crumb mixture for a more complex flavor.
  • Air Fryer Option: For a healthier alternative, you can air fry the breaded tortellini.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C). Spray the breaded tortellini with cooking spray and air fry for 8-10 minutes, or until golden brown and crispy, flipping halfway through.

Storage

While these are best enjoyed fresh, you can store leftover fried tortellini in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Reheat them in the oven or air fryer to restore some of their crispiness.

Reheating Instructions

To reheat,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Spread the leftover tortellini on a baking sheet and bake for 5-10 minutes, or until heated through and crispy. You can also reheat them in an air fryer at 350°F (175°C) for 3-5 minutes.

Parmesan Fried Tortellini: A Crispy, Cheesy Delight


  • Author: kitchenyumm
  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Diet: Vegetarian
Print Recipe
Pin Recipe

Description

Parmesan Fried Tortellini: A Crispy, Cheesy Delight is the ultimate party appetizer or snack! Perfectly breaded tortellini fried to golden brown, packed with flavor and served with marinara for dipping. Quick to make and always a crowd-pleaser—try this fun and easy finger food today!


Ingredients

– 1 (9-ounce) package refrigerated cheese tortellini

– 1 cup all-purpose flour

– 2 large eggs

– 2 tablespoons milk

– 1 cup Italian-style breadcrumbs

– 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ese

– 1 teaspoon garlic powder

– 1/2 teaspoon Italian seasoning

– Vegetable oil, for frying

– Marinara sauce, for serving


Instructions

1. Cook tortellini according to package directions, then drain and let cool.

2. Place flour in one shallow bowl. In a second bowl, whisk together eggs and milk. In a third bowl, combine bre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, garlic powder, and Italian seasoning.

3. Dredge each tortellini in flour, then dip in the egg mixture, and finally coat with the breadcrumb mixture.

4. Heat about 2 inches of vegetable oil in a deep skillet over medium-high heat.

5. Fry tortellini in batches for 2–3 minutes or until golden brown and crispy.

6. Remove and drain on paper towels.

7. Serve hot with marinara sauce for dipping.

Notes

– For extra flavor, sprinkle fried tortellini with additional Parmesan right after frying.

– Great as a party appetizer or game day snack.

– Air fryer option: Cook at 375°F for 8–10 minutes, flipping halfway through.

– Best served fresh, but leftovers can be reheated in the oven for crispiness.
